Shop Scamming Me?

Had my A4 4l60e rebuilt a few days short of a year ago. Anyhow warrenty is 12k or 1 year, anyhow its no where near 12k and the year is almost up. In second I think it is, 60mph if i hit it, it will go to 7k and wont shift sometimes and Madz28 set it to shift at 6400 and sometimes it hits it and shifts good and many times it misses you have to let off so it grabs. Ok so i go to the shop the other day thursday to be exact, and he drives it and comes back and says yea i see what your saying. I told him it was rebuilt, and he asked by who i said right here your shop. Then he goes on to say well the exaust is too free flowing, so i said ill buy a new exhaust, then he proceeds to tell me the pcm is not telling the transmission to shift from 2nd to 3rd. So i said ill get it reprogramed again. Basicly i feel they dont want to own up to their warrenty. I said ill do all that and then will is shift, he said well theres no guarantee that , that will solve the problem. I said are you saying that its not the transmission, he said well no im not saying that its just unlikely. He tells me to get online and ask around for advise lol I was thinking WTFFFFFF. Basicly I feel im getting F'd over, im going to call them monday and tell them i want my warrenty honored or im going to the BBB on them. What do you guys think, and whats bad is I know its not MadZ's tune because sometimes it hits and sometimes it doesnt. I think their trying to push their problems off on other things/places instead of whats really wrong. and i told the guy before i had it rebuilt it was doing the exact same thing in the same gear and then it went from what was problems shifting at WOT in 60 to first gear. They are trying to screw you, just like every other shop out there. The PCM doesn't "not tell the transmission to shift". If that was the case you wouldn't be driving anywhere. Second, a free flowing exhaust has nothing to do with the transmission at all. The exhaust has to do with the exhaust and back pressure on the engine, in no way does that effect the shifting of the transmission.
